    Learn more about Human Resources Course programs in USA

    Studying Human Resources at the Courses level in the USA equips you with the essential knowledge and skills for managing an organization’s most valuable asset: its people. This field combines theoretical learning with real-world application, allowing for a comprehensive understanding of workplace dynamics and talent management.

    You'll cover various topics, such as employee relations, talent acquisition strategies, and organizational behavior. Courses focus on developing competencies in conflict resolution, performance management, and workforce planning. These skills are crucial for effectively supporting and enhancing organizational culture. Many students build confidence as they engage with new perspectives and case studies, preparing for successful careers.

    Graduates can expect diverse career opportunities, including roles as HR managers, recruitment specialists, and training coordinators. The USA's emphasis on interactive learning fosters adaptability and critical thinking, providing a strong foundation for navigating the complexities of human resources in various industries. Whether you’re interested in improving employee engagement or driving organizational change, this degree will help you pursue a fulfilling career in HR.
